Transaction e582002590953dc9b01c5c1c75607305ce25de53999ade5bae890dfb277c5733
1 Input
1 Output
-
e582002590953dc9b01c5c1c75607305ce25de53999ade5bae890dfb277c5733:0
- value
- 88743
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a217e8288af325437b6e5d84c7c0658656fe438
- address
- bc1qrgshaq5g4ue9gdakuhvyclqxtpjklepczkwwgs